Fuel Pump Information for the 2017 Lexus IS

The 2017 Lexus IS definitely comes equipped with a fuel pump, as it is a crucial component in the vehicle's fuel delivery system. Like most modern petrol-powered cars, the Lexus IS uses an electric fuel pump to transfer fuel from the tank to the engine. This means the fuel pump plays an essential role in ensuring the engine runs smoothly and efficiently by maintaining a steady flow of fuel under the right pressure.

The fuel pump is typically located inside the fuel tank itself, which helps reduce noise and vibration while providing consistent fuel flow. Without a properly functioning fuel pump, the engine would either starve for fuel or run poorly, making it impossible to maintain performance or fuel economy.

Generally, the fuel pump in a car like the 2017 Lexus IS is a high-pressure, electric type. Its job is to pressurise the petrol and send it through the fuel lines and fuel injectors where it mixes with air and combusts in the engine cylinders. This precise control over fuel delivery is vital, especially on modern forced induction or direct injection engines, like those found in the IS models.

When it comes to maintaining or replacing the fuel pump on a 2017 Lexus IS, there are a few handy points to keep in mind. The fuel pump doesn't require frequent attention like oil or air filters, but it is still one of those components that can wear out over time.

If the fuel pump starts to struggle, owners might notice some classic warning signs. These include hard starting, engine stalling, loss of power, or unusual whining noises coming from the fuel tank area. Sometimes, poor fuel economy or rough idling can also hint at fuel pump issues. It's important not to ignore these signs because a failing pump can leave the driver stranded.

Regular servicing of the fuel pump itself isn't typically listed in standard maintenance schedules, but keeping other fuel system components in good shape can help prolong the fuel pump's life. For example, regularly replacing the fuel filter (where applicable) and making sure the fuel tank is clean of debris can reduce the strain on the pump. The fuel pump relies on the fuel itself to keep it cool and lubricated, so running the car consistently with very low fuel levels can cause premature failure.

If a fuel pump replacement becomes necessary, the job usually involves removing the rear seats and accessing the fuel pump through the top of the fuel tank. This can be a moderately complex job best left to professional mechanics familiar with the Lexus IS's design. Once replaced, it's important to use OEM (original equipment manufacturer) or high-quality aftermarket pumps to ensure reliability and correct fuel pressure.

One important note: the fuel delivery system on the Lexus IS incorporates several sensors and electronic controls that work alongside the fuel pump. Any replacement or repair job should also include checking the fuel pressure regulator, fuel injectors, and associated wiring to prevent future issues.
